How much do multimedia eng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 25, 2026, the average yearly pay for multimedia engineer in Ohio is $98,991.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$76,100.00 and $125,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a multimedia engineer?

A Multimedia Engineer is responsible for designing, developing, and maintaining multimedia systems, including audio, video, animation, and interactive content. They work with software and hardware to ensure seamless integration of multimedia elements in various applications, such as websites, games, virtual reality, and digital marketing. Their role involves troubleshooting technical issues, optimizing performance, and collaborating with designers and developers to create engaging user experiences.

What does a multimedia engineer do?

A typical day for a Multimedia Engineer involves designing, developing, and testing multimedia applications such as interactive websites, virtual environments, or digital presentations. This may include collaborating closely with designers, developers, and content creators to integrate visual, audio, and interactive components. Engineers often troubleshoot technical issues, optimize media performance, and ensure compatibility across multiple platforms. You can expect a mix of technical problem-solving, creative input, and teamwork in fast-paced project settings.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the multimedia engineer position, and why are they important?

A Multimedia Engineer needs a solid background in computer science, digital media, and audio/visual technology, often supported by a relevant degree or certification. Expertise with multimedia software (such as Adobe Creative Suite, Unity, or video/sound editing tools), programming languages (like C++ or JavaScript), and familiarity with content management systems are typically required. Strong problem-solving skills, creativity, and effective communication are vital soft skills in this role. These competencies ensure high-quality multimedia content is developed, integrated, and maintained efficiently in dynamic technical environments.

Is there a demand for multimedia engineer careers?

The demand for multimedia engineers remains strong due to the growth of digital media, entertainment, advertising, and online content creation. Skills in video production, graphic design, animation, and proficiency with tools like Adobe Creative Suite are highly valued, and employment opportunities are available across various industries including tech, media, and marketing.

Job Description

The Multimedia Communications Design Specialist will work out of the AECOM office in Columbus, OH.This media design specialist develops innovative communications products that enhance public engagement, support technical project delivery, and strengthen client communications across a variety of digital platforms. Working collaboratively with graphic designers, engineers, planners, public involvement specialists, GIS professionals, and project managers, this position transforms complex technical information into engaging, accessible, and visually compelling digital experiences.

  • Responsibilities include creating animated presentations, motion graphics, website graphics, digital newsletters, email campaigns, social media content, interactive communication materials, and multimedia assets that support engineering, transportation, planning, and public outreach initiatives.
  • This role plays a key part in developing communication products that help agencies explain transportation projects, visualize technical concepts, support public meetings, deliver online training, communicate project updates, and improve stakeholder engagement through digital-first communication strategies.
  • The Multimedia Communications Design Specialist serves as the team's subject matter resource for multimedia production, digital communication technologies, motion graphics, and emerging communication platforms. By identifying new tools, production techniques, and digital communication strategies, this position expands the team's ability to deliver engaging, innovative, and accessible communication products while supporting the evolving needs of clients and the communities they serve.

Digital Content Development

  • Design digital communication materials for web, email, presentations, social media, and interactive platforms.
  • Develop branded graphics for websites, newsletters, email campaigns, client portals, and digital outreach initiatives.
  • Adapt print and presentation materials for digital-first communication channels.

Motion Graphics & Animation

  • Produce motion graphics, animated diagrams, and multimedia presentations to communicate technical information and project updates.
  • Develop simple animations illustrating transportation concepts, roadway improvements, project phasing, traffic operations, and public engagement materials.
  • Convert presentation content into video-based training materials and digital learning resources.

Multimedia Production

  • Create and edit multimedia assets including narrated presentations, animated infographics, short-form videos, captioned content, and translated media.
  • Integrate graphics, voiceover, subtitles, and multilingual content into accessible digital communications.

Digital Platforms

  • Develop graphics and digital assets for websites, email marketing platforms, social media, and online communication campaigns.
  • Support content updates for web pages, client portals, and digital outreach initiatives.
